1. PURPOSE
To protect the privacy and confidentiality of Member and Guest information.
2. POLICY
Your privacy is important to the London Club, Limited (“the Club”). We strive to provide you with the best customer service, treating you fairly and with respect. You have shared important personal information with us, and you did this so we could serve you better. To uphold your trust, we are also committed to meeting the privacy standards applicable to you. The purpose of this policy is to tell you what personal information we collect, how we use it, whether we disclose it to anybody else, how long we keep it, and how you can request access to your personal information.

Purposes of Collection:
We ask you for personal information to establish and serve you as a member or customer. We consider personal information to mean information recorded in any form, about an identified individual, or an individual whose identity may be inferred or determined from the information. Business contact information is not generally considered personal information. We obtain most of our information about you directly from you. We collect personal information from Our Members, Our Prospective Members, Our Party Customers, Our Employees, guests of Members, and other individuals who make inquiries with us or purchase goods and services from the Club. Listed below are the types of personal information we collect, and for what purpose we collect this information.
Prospective Members:
Prospective members will be asked to complete a Membership Application form, which will require you to provide personal information for the purpose of assessing your eligibility for membership. This may include, but not be limited to, your name, address, phone number, email
address, birth date, payment information, occupation, and employment.
Members:
Once accepted to membership, we may collect additional personal information from you in the course of providing our services to you. This may include your name, address, phone number, e-mail address, which will be used for general business use and inclusion in the annually
produced Membership Roster (in print and electronic form through the members-only password protected area of our website). Your membership status will also be published in our Membership Roster. This will permit us and other members of the Club to contact you.
We may also take your photograph for identification purposes and publication on our on- line Membership Roster and our Point-of-Sale system. From time to time, we may also take photographs during Club events. Photographs may be published throughout the Club and on
our website.
We may continue to use your birth date to determine your eligibility for membership classifications or other products for which you may qualify because of your particular age group.
We may continue to use your payment information such as account number, credit card number, and the name and address of your bank. This may be used to assess your eligibility for membership in the Club. We will also use this information to process payments of membership
fees and charges for other goods and services. We will also maintain information regarding the purchases you have made at the Club for accounting purposes.
We may continue to use information about your occupation and employer to determine potential areas of expertise of our members, to possibly seek insight on specialized issues from you. Further, as we make every effort to support our members, it may be used when seeking a specific good or service for the Club for which we are seeking a supplier.
Parties/Events:
When you are organizing a private party/event at the Club, we will need to collect personal information from you to provide our services to you. This may include, but not be limited to, your name, address, phone number, email address and payment information (including
credit card number).
Guests and Other Individuals:
If you visit the Club as the guest of a member, if you make inquiries about the Club, and/or if you purchase goods or services at the Club or provide goods and services to the Club, we may collect personal information from you. This may include your name, address, e-mail address, phone number, and payment information (including credit card number) where it is necessary for the purpose of providing our goods and services to you, receiving goods and services from you, or for answering your inquiries.
Consent:
Consent is required for the collection of personal information and the subsequent use or disclosure of this information. Your provision of personal information to the Club means that you agree and consent that we may collect, use, and disclose your personal information in
accordance with this Privacy Policy. In addition, specific authorizations or consents may be obtained from time to time. The reasonable expectations of the individual are considered when using this information.
If you submit an application on behalf of a family member, you represent that you have obtained consent from them, even though they may not be present during the application process, to the collection, use and disclosure of their personal information for the identified purposes.
Limiting of Collection, Use, Disclosure:
We only collect the information we need and only use it for the purposes explained to you. When you apply for membership, we indicate in the application form how we intend to use your information. Likewise, when a private party customer signs a Banquet Contract, we will indicate on the agreement how we intend to use your information. If we wish in the future to use it for another purpose, we will ask for your consent at that time.
We may contact employers or other personal references to verify information that you have given us. We will not do this without your consent, but please remember that if you do not give your consent we may not be able to grant your membership application.
In some cases, we may engage service providers located outside of Canada and we may need to share your personal information with them for the purpose of obtaining services. Therefore, some personal information collected by the Club may be retained in countries other than
Canada (such as the United States) where privacy laws may offer different levels of protection from those in Canada and Personal Information may be subject to access by and disclosure to law enforcement agencies in those jurisdictions.
We do not sell your personal information to third parties. We may share some of your
personal information with third parties such as our 3rd party app and reciprocal clubs’ organizations of which we are affiliated with. We may also disclose your personal information where we are required or permitted by law to do so.
We retain your information only as long as it is required for the reasons it was collected. This period may extend beyond the end of your relationship with us but only for so long as it is legally necessary for us to have sufficient information to respond to any issue that may arise at a later date. If there are legal requirements relating to the period of time which we must retain your personal information, we comply with those requirements. When your information is no longer needed for the purposes explained to you, we have procedures to destroy, delete, erase or convert it to an anonymous form.
Accuracy:
You have the right to request that personal information, which you believe to be inaccurate, be corrected. We will make every reasonable effort to keep your information accurate and up-to date. Having accurate information about you enables us to give you the best possible service.
You can help by keeping us informed of any changes, such as email update, if you move or change telephone numbers. If you find any errors in our information about you, let us know immediately.
Protecting Information:
We use your personal information only for the purposes identified above and access to your personal information is limited to those employees, service providers, members of the Board, and members of the London Club, Limited who need to have access to it.
We will protect your information with appropriate safeguards and security measures, by physical measures, organizational measures, and technological measures.
Providing Information Access:
You have a right to access the personal information which we have about you. We may charge a reasonable cost (e.g., photocopying, mail charges) to the individual making the request. The Club reserves the right to decline to provide access where the information request would
disclose the personal information of another individual, disclose trade secrets or other confidential business information, is subject to solicitor-client or litigation privilege, is not readily retrievable, could reasonably result in harm if disclosed, or other grounds permitted by law. If you wish to access this information you should contact our Privacy Officer and/or Privacy working group who will be pleased to assist you.
On-Line Privacy Concerns:
Our web servers track general information about visitors such as their domain name, time of visit, IP address, type and version of browser and which pages are being accessed. This information is used only in aggregate form, to better serve visitors by helping us to:
Manage our site;
Diagnose any technical problems; and
Improve the content of our website.
When you go directly to the information portion of our website and move from page to page, read pages or download content onto your computer, we learn which pages are visited, what content is downloaded, and the (browser) address of websites that was visited immediately
before coming to our website. However, none of this is directly associated with you as an individual. It is measured only in aggregate.
We use this information to find out how many people visit our website and which sections of the site is visited most frequently. This helps us to know what type of information is most useful to you so that we can improve our site and make it easier for you to access information. We
record the statistical information on the numbers of visitors to our website, but no information about you in particular will be kept or used.
When you send us an e-mail or when you ask us to respond to you by email, we learn your exact email address and any information you have included in the email. We use your e-mail address to acknowledge your comments and/or reply to your questions, and we will store your communication and our reply in case we correspond further. We will not sell your email address to anyone outside the London Club, Limited. We may use your email address to send you information about news or specific events that we believe may be of interest to you. If you don’t want us to contact you by email with this information, you may tell us so at any time. If you have asked us to put you on an email mailing list to provide you with certain information on a regular basis, you may ask us to remove you from the list at any time.
We have no control over the content of third-party websites that individuals may access through hyperlinks at our website. We encourage everyone to read the privacy policy of every website they visit.
Some portions of our website are accessible only to members and require a valid Login ID and password. Such personal information will only be used for authentication purposes and other purposes as stated in this Policy.
Respecting and Responding to your Privacy Concerns:
If you contact us, we will explain your options of refusing or withdrawing consent to the collection, use or release of your information, and we will record and respect your choices. In most cases, you are free to refuse or withdraw your consent at any time by contacting our Privacy Officer and/or Privacy working group.
If you have a complaint related to this Privacy Policy, or any of our procedures, please contact our Privacy Officer and/or Privacy working group. We will endeavor to respond to your request within 30 days. If your complaint is justified, we will take the steps necessary to resolve the issue, including amending our Policy and practices if necessary.
If we are not able to resolve your concerns, you may contact the Office of the Privacy Commissioner of Canada at 613-995-8210 or toll-free at 1-800-282-1376.
